A forward-thinking payment solutions company in Swindon seeks an Engineering Delivery Lead to oversee the successful delivery of initiatives across engineering. You will manage the engineering roadmap, align teams, and improve delivery processes. The ideal candidate will have experience in agile environments, strong people management skills, and an ability to drive projects to completion. Join a collaborative culture that values your contributions and offers career development opportunities in a hybrid work setting.

How to prepare for a job interview at Edenred PayTech
β¨Know Your Agile Inside Out
Make sure you brush up on your agile methodologies before the interview. Be ready to discuss how you've successfully implemented agile practices in past projects and how they improved delivery processes. This will show that you understand the core principles and can apply them effectively.
β¨Showcase Your People Management Skills
Prepare examples of how you've managed teams in the past, especially in challenging situations. Highlight your ability to motivate and align teams towards a common goal. This is crucial for the Engineering Delivery Lead role, so be ready to demonstrate your leadership style and how it fosters collaboration.
β¨Familiarise Yourself with the Company Culture
Research the companyβs values and culture, especially their approach to collaboration and career development. During the interview, relate your own values and experiences to theirs. This will help you connect with the interviewers and show that youβre a good fit for their team.
β¨Prepare for Scenario-Based Questions
Expect questions that ask you to solve hypothetical problems or improve existing processes. Think about specific scenarios where youβve driven projects to completion and be ready to explain your thought process. This will demonstrate your problem-solving skills and your ability to think on your feet.
